HYD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2018 in Review

181 of the 4,363 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in VanEck High Yield Muni ETF (HYD) for Q1 2018, worth a combined $1.17B — up 11% from $1.06B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 25 funds opened new HYD positions and 24 closed out — a net gain of 1 holder — while 74 added to existing stakes and 52 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Bank of America, adding an estimated $95.9M. The largest seller was Grimes & Company, exiting entirely with an estimated $32.9M sold.
